全書分為三大篇共12章,根據原理圖和PCB設計流程分別介紹了Protel DXP 2004的原理圖和PCB設計的基本操作、編輯環境設定、元器件封裝生成、電氣規則檢查、層次原理圖設計、PCB生成和布局布線、各種報表的生成、信號完整性分析、電路的仿真、FPGA設計、原理圖與PCB設計綜合實例等內容。
基本介紹
- 書名:零點起飛學Protel DXP 2004 原理與PCB設計
- ISBN:9787302335054
- 定價:69元
- 出版時間:2014-5-29 0:00:40
- 裝幀:平裝
圖書簡介,圖書目錄,
圖書簡介
本書面向Protel DXP 2004初級讀者,全書分為三大篇共12章,根據原理圖和PCB設計流程分別介紹了Protel DXP 2004的原理圖和PCB設計的基本操作、編輯環境設定、元器件封裝生成、電氣規則檢查、層次原理圖設計、PCB生成和布局布線、各種報表的生成、信號完整性分析、電路的仿真、FPGA設計、原理圖與PCB設計綜合實例等內容。
圖書目錄
第1章 Protel DXP 2004概述 1
1.1 Protel DXP 2004的組成與特點 1
1.1.1 Protel DXP 2004的組成 1
1.1.2 Protel DXP 2004的特點 2
1.1.3 Protel DXP 2004的SP2升級包新特點 3
1.2 Protel DXP 2004軟體的安裝 3
1.2.1 Protel DXP 2004的安裝 4
1.2.2 Protel DXP 2004的啟動與中英文界面切換 8
1.3 Protel DXP 2004集成環境 11
1.3.1 Protel DXP工作區 11
1.3.2 標題欄 12
1.3.3 選單欄 12
1.3.4 工作區面板 12
1.3.5 工具列和狀態欄 13
1.4 電路板的總體設計流程 14
1.5 本章小結 14
1.6 思考與練習 15
第2章 Protel DXP原理圖設計入門 16
2.1 原理圖的設計流程 16
2.2 啟動原理圖編輯器 17
2.3 圖紙參數和環境參數的設定 19
2.3.1 設定【文檔選項】 19
2.3.2 設定原理圖工作環境參數 22
2.4 裝入元器件庫 26
2.5 放置元器件 29
2.5.1 利用庫檔案面板放置元器件 29
2.5.2 利用選單命令放置元件 30
2.5.3 刪除元件 32
2.5.4 調整元件位置 33
2.5.5 編輯元件屬性 36
2.6 繪製電路原理圖 39
2.6.1 【布線】工具列 39
2.6.2 繪製導線 40
2.6.3 放置電源及接地符號 41
2.6.4 設定網路標號 43
2.6.5 繪製匯流排 45
2.6.6 繪製匯流排分支線(Bus Entry) 46
2.6.7 繪製電路的輸入/輸出連線埠 47
2.6.8 放置節點 49
2.7 實例講解 50
2.8 本章小結 56
2.9 思考與練習 57
第3章 製作元件和建立元件庫 58
3.1 使用元器件庫編輯器 58
3.2 啟動元器件庫編輯器 58
3.3 元器件庫編輯器界面的組成 60
3.3.1 元器件管理 60
3.3.2 設定別名 60
3.3.3 引腳管理 60
3.4 常用繪製工具的使用 62
3.4.1 常用繪圖工具 62
3.4.2 繪製引腳 63
3.4.3 繪製直線 65
3.4.4 繪製多邊形 66
3.4.5 繪製橢圓弧 69
3.4.6 繪製橢圓 70
3.4.7 繪製貝塞爾曲線 72
3.4.8 繪製矩形 73
3.4.9 繪製餅圖 75
3.4.10 放置文本字元串 77
3.4.11 插入圖片 79
3.5 圖件的複製、剪下、貼上與排列 81
3.5.1 選中和取消選中圖件 81
3.5.2 圖件的複製、貼上 83
3.5.3 圖件的陣列貼上 85
3.6 元器件的排列與對齊 86
3.7 元器件的製作 89
3.7.1 元器件的製作 89
3.7.2 複製元器件 93
3.8 生成元器件報表 95
3.8.1 元器件報表輸出 95
3.8.2 元器件規則檢查報表 96
3.8.3 元器件庫報表 97
3.9 創建集成元器件庫 97
3.9.1 創建集成元器件庫項目檔案 98
3.9.2 添加庫檔案 98
3.9.3 編譯集成元器件庫項目檔案 98
3.10 實例講解 100
3.11 本章小結 103
3.12 思考與練習 103
第4章 電氣規則檢查(ERC)及網路表 105
4.1 原理圖的電氣規則檢查(ERC) 105
4.1.1 ERC的設定及套用 105
4.1.2 設定電氣連線矩陣(Connection Matrix) 107
4.1.3 ERC結果報告 108
4.2 創建網路表 110
4.2.1 通過單個原理圖文檔生成網路表 110
4.2.2 通過項目生成網路表 111
4.2.3 網路表的格式 113
4.3 生成元器件列表 114
4.4 生成元器件交叉參考表 115
4.5 列印輸出原理圖 116
4.5.1 頁面設定 116
4.5.2 列印預覽 117
4.5.3 設定印表機 117
4.6 實例講解 118
4.7 本章小結 121
4.8 思考與練習 122
第5章 層次式原理圖設計 123
5.1 層次式原理圖的設計方法 123
5.1.1 層次式電路原理圖的設計方法 123
5.1.2 自上而下設計層次式電路原理圖 124
5.1.3 自下而上的設計方法 129
5.2 層次原理圖之間的切換 132
5.3 生成層次原理圖的報表 135
5.4 實例講解 136
5.5 本章小結 141
5.6 思考與練習 141
第6章 PCB設計基礎 143
6.1 PCB圖的設計流程 143
6.2 PCB文檔的基本操作 144
6.2.1 PCB板的組成 144
6.2.2 PCB板的結構 145
6.2.3 PCB板的分層及顏色設定 145
6.2.4 PCB文檔的創建 148
6.2.5 PCB文檔的保存和打開 155
6.2.6 PCB設計界面 155
6.3 PCB環境參數的設定 156
6.3.1 圖紙參數的設定 156
6.3.2 PCB編輯器的參數設定 158
6.4 PCB中圖件的放置 160
6.4.1 放置圓弧 160
6.4.2 放置矩形填充 164
6.4.3 放置銅區域 165
6.4.4 放置字元串 167
6.4.5 放置焊盤 167
6.4.6 放置過孔 168
6.4.7 放置導線 169
6.4.8 放置元器件 171
6.4.9 放置坐標 172
6.4.10 放置尺寸 173
6.4.11 規劃PCB板的物理邊界和電氣邊界 175
6.5 載入PCB元件庫 176
6.6 載入網路表和元器件 177
6.7 PCB布局與布線 178
6.7.1 自動布局 178
6.7.2 手動調整布局 180
6.7.3 元器件標註的調整 181
6.7.4 元器件布局的自動調整 182
6.7.5 元器件的手工布局 184
6.7.6 Room空間 184
6.7.7 網路密度分析 186
6.7.8 3D效果圖 186
6.7.9 設定自動布線規則 187
6.7.10 自動布線 193
6.7.11 手動布線 197
6.7.12 放置覆銅 200
6.7.13 補淚滴 202
6.8 本章小結 203
6.9 思考與練習 203
第7章 PCB報表的生成與列印 204
7.1 PCB各種報表的生成 204
7.1.1 生成電路板信息報表 204
7.1.2 生成網路狀態報表 206
7.1.3 生成設計層次報表 207
7.1.4 生成元器件報表 207
7.1.5 生成元器件交叉參考表 210
7.1.6 生成其他報表 210
7.1.7 各種測量數據的輸出 211
7.2 PCB圖檔案的保存和列印 213
7.2.1 列印頁面的設定 213
7.2.2 列印層面設定 216
7.2.3 印表機設定 217
7.2.4 列印預覽 219
7.3 本章小結 220
7.4 思考與練習 220
第8章 製作PCB元件 221
8.1 元器件封裝庫編輯器 221
8.1.1 創建PCB元器件封裝庫檔案 221
8.1.2 元器件封裝庫編輯器介紹 223
8.2 添加新的元器件封裝 223
8.2.1 設定元器件封裝參數 224
8.2.2 創建新的元器件封裝 224
8.3 利用嚮導建立庫檔案 228
8.4 PCB元器件封裝庫的管理 230
8.4.1 瀏覽管理器 230
8.4.2 向庫中添加元器件封裝 231
8.4.3 元器件封裝重命名 231
8.4.4 刪除元器件封裝 232
8.4.5 複製、剪下元器件封裝 232
8.4.6 元器件封裝報告 232
8.5 創建集成元器件庫 233
8.6 本章小結 235
8.7 思考與練習 235
第9章 信號完整性分析 237
9.1 信號完整性概述 237
9.1.1 信號完整性的主要表現 237
9.1.2 常見信號完整性問題及其解決方案 238
9.1.3 信號完整性分析器 239
9.2 信號完整性分析注意事項 240
9.3 添加信號完整性模型 240
9.4 信號完整性分析設定 245
9.4.1 在PCB編輯環境下進行信號完整性規則的設定 245
9.4.2 在原理圖編輯環境下進行信號完整性規則的設定 251
9.4.3 信號完整性分析設定 252
9.5 實例講解 261
9.6 本章小結 271
9.7 思考與練習 271
第10章 Protel DXP電路仿真技術 272
10.1 Protel DXP仿真概述 272
10.1.1 Protel DXP電路仿真的特點 272
10.1.2 Protel DXP仿真電路圖 273
10.2 Protel DXP仿真步驟 273
10.3 主要仿真元器件 274
10.3.1 查找仿真元器件 274
10.3.2 設定仿真元器件的參數 276
10.3.3 常用仿真元器件庫 278
10.4 仿真信號源 287
10.4.1 直流信號激勵源 288
10.4.2 正弦信號激勵源 288
10.4.3 脈衝信號激勵源 289
10.4.4 調頻信號激勵源 290
10.4.5 指數函式激勵源 291
10.4.6 特殊的仿真元器件 292
10.5 仿真數學函式館 294
10.6 仿真模式設定 294
10.6.1 【General Setup】設定 295
10.6.2 工作點分析 296
10.6.3 瞬態/傅立葉分析 296
10.6.4 直流掃描分析 298
10.6.5 交流小信號分析 299
10.6.6 噪聲分析 300
10.6.7 極點-零點分析 301
10.6.8 傳遞函式分析 301
10.6.9 溫度掃描分析 302
10.6.10 參數掃描分析 303
10.6.11 蒙特卡羅分析 304
10.6.12 高級仿真參數設定 305
10.7 仿真顯示視窗的設定 306
10.8 實例講解 311
10.8.1 實例:簡單電路仿真實例 311
10.8.2 實例:共射放大電路的靜態工作點分析 317
10.8.3 實例:電路瞬態分析 318
10.8.4 實例:傅立葉分析 320
10.8.5 實例:直流掃描分析 322
10.8.6 實例:交流小信號分析 323
10.8.7 實例:噪聲分析 324
10.8.8 實例:極點-零點分析 325
10.8.9 實例:傳遞函式分析 326
10.8.10 實例:蒙特卡羅分析 328
10.8.11 實例:參數掃描分析 330
10.8.12 實例:溫度掃描分析 331
10.9 本章小結 333
10.10 思考與練習 333
第11章DXP環境下的FPGA設計 334
11.1FPGA設計初步 334
11.1.1FPGA的基本概念 334
11.1.2FPGA設計流程 336
11.1.3VHDL語言簡介 339
11.2對VHDL和原理圖的混合設計與仿真 341
11.2.1創建一個FPGA項目 342
11.2.2創建頂層原理圖文檔 344
11.2.3編譯項目,由頂層原理圖創建VHDL文檔 347
11.2.4為VHDL創建測試平台 350
11.2.5設定仿真環境 351
11.2.6系統仿真 352
11.3FPGA屬性設定 354
11.3.1一般屬性 354
11.3.2高級屬性 355
11.4ProtelDXP和AlteraFPGA接口 356
11.5實例講解——VHDL與原理圖的混合設計 357
11.5.1創建一個FPGA項目 357
11.5.2向項目中添加文檔 358
11.5.3創建頂層原理圖文檔 360
11.5.4編譯項目,由頂層原理圖創建VHDL文檔 363
11.5.5為VHDL創建測試平台 366
11.5.6設定仿真環境 368
11.5.7系統仿真 369
11.6本章小結 371
11.7思考與練習 372
第12章綜合實例 373
12.1儀用放大器電路設計 373
12.1.1創建項目檔案 373
12.1.2原理圖設計 374
12.1.3報表生成 380
12.1.4創建PCB檔案 382
12.1.5PCB布局 385
12.1.6PCB布線 387
12.1.7設計規則檢查 389
12.1.83D效果圖 390
12.2八路流水燈的設計 390
12.2.1創建項目檔案 391
12.2.2原理圖設計 391
12.2.3報表生成 398
12.2.4創建PCB檔案 401
12.2.5PCB布局 405
12.2.6PCB布線 406
12.2.7設計規則檢查 408
12.2.83D效果圖 409
12.3頻率計電路的設計 410
12.3.1創建項目檔案 410
12.3.2原理圖設計 410
12.3.3報表生成 418
12.3.4創建PCB檔案 420
12.3.5PCB布局 424
12.3.6PCB布線 425
12.3.7設計規則檢查 427
12.3.83D效果圖 428
12.4本章小結 428
12.5思考與練習 428